Azeri Oil Prices Moved Up

Oil&Gas Materials 6 February 2007 19:13 (UTC +04:00)

On February 5 AZERI LT FOB Ceyhan oil price was $58,33 per barrel (up $1,71 per barrel as compared to the previous day). On February 5, AZERI LT CIF Augusta oil price was $59,29 per barrel (+ $59,29 per barrel), Trend reports.

Azeri Light oil is produced from Azeri-Chirag-Gunashli offshore fields, which is developed under BP operatorship. Without any mixing with other brands of oil it is delivered to the Turkish port of Ceyhan via the Baku-Tbilisi-Ceyhan main export oil pipeline, to the Georgian port of Supsa via the Baku-Supsa pipeline and to the Georgian port of Batumi by railway. Density of Azeri Light is 34.8 degrees by API, sulphur content is 0.15%.

On February 5, the price of URAL (EX-NOVO) was $51,59 per barrel (+$1,62 per barrel).

Azerbaijan exports URAL oil from the Novorossiysk port, which is delivered via the Baku-Novorossiysk pipeline. The high quality Azerbaijani oil, including Azeri Light, is blended with other oil brands in the Russian pipeline system and is sold from the Novorossiysk in the type of URAL. Density of URAL is 30.4-31.85 degrees by API, sulphur content is up to 1.8%.

The price of Dated Brent was $58,34per barrel (+$1,52 per barrel).

Density of Dated Brent is 38.3 degrees API, sulphur content 0.36%.
